Actually the "leaked" game was a hoax. But a very good one that in some ways was close to the real game that year. Inspectors and Refs were still trying to correct misconceptions at Nationals that were brought on by the hoax. Lots of showing people things in the rule books. Pdfs were either just coming into fashion or not invented yet so everything was on paper and teams didn't always print complete rules for everybody either. That did not help things.

I won't mention the name of the prominent FIRSTer who pulled this one. Their very prominence gave the story credibility it would not have had otherwise which contributed to the damage. The perpitrator apologized and swore never to do such a thing again, and they haven't. So we just remember it and tell the story every now and then as a caution not to believe everything you read on CD. I think it was around then that CD added the Rumor Mill.



BTW never EVER believe what you read in the Rumor Mill. That area of CD is strictly for amusement.
